Prohibited uses

You may not use Laplace to:

  • Upload content you don't have the rights to, or that infringes intellectual property or privacy.
  • Process sensitive personal data in violation of applicable law, or build models intended to unlawfully identify, surveil, or discriminate against people.
  • Generate models or analyses for unlawful, harmful, deceptive, or harassing purposes.
  • Attempt to breach security, evade quotas or billing, reverse-engineer the service, or access other tenants' data.
  • Run malware, crypto-mining, denial-of-service, or other abusive workloads on our compute.
  • Resell or sublicense the service except as expressly permitted.

High-stakes and regulated uses

Laplace outputs are advisory decision-support, not professional advice. You must not use Laplace as the sole or primary basis for decisions in medical diagnosis or treatment, legal determinations, credit/insurance/employment eligibility, safety-critical engineering, or other regulated or high-risk contexts without independent expert validation and appropriate compliance controls. Fair use of compute

Plans include quotas and per-run and monthly GPU caps. Sustained abuse, attempts to circumvent limits, or workloads that threaten platform stability may be throttled or suspended.
